Title:
METHOD FOR DECREASING BUBBLE LIFETIME ON A GLASS MELT SURFACE
Document Type and Number:
WIPO Patent Application WO/2018/170392
Kind Code:
A3
Abstract:
A method of reducing bubble lifetime on the free surface of a volume of molten glass contained within or flowing through a vessel including a free volume above the free surface, thereby minimizing re-entrainment of the bubbles back into the volume of molten glass and reducing the occurrence of blisters in finished glass products.
